Yakima City Council Oct. 5th Regular Meeting Review

The Yakima City Council held a regular meeting yesterday, Tuesday, October 5th. Action taken by the Council yesterday included: Receiving the 2021 first and second quarter Capital Improvement Projects Report Approving Anderson Park Annexation contingent on Yakima County Boundary Review Board approval Authorizing federal grant application for up to $500,000 under the Economic Development Administration

Parking Lot at Gardner Park to be Paved

City of Yakima crews will be paving the parking lot at the City’s Gardner Park beginning on Monday, September 27th.  The surface of the parking lot has been gravel for many years. Sunfair Parade Kicks Off Fair Season

After a year’s hiatus due to COVID-19, the Yakima Sunfair Parade will follow its familiar route of more than one-and-a-half miles through Downtown Yakima on Saturday, September 25th.  The parade begins at 10:00 am and is anticipated to last until 1:00 pm. Tree Trimming to Close Section of 6th Street

A tree trimming project will require closing 6th Street on Thursday morning, September 23rd, between Spruce Street and Pine Street.
